KKR borrows $8.6M from Berkeley Point for property acquisition in Bushwick
Kohlberg Kravis Roberts & Co. through the entity KRE Bklyner 412 Evergreen LLC as borrower signed a loan agreement with lender Berkeley Point Capital LLC valued at $8.6 million to finance the purchase of 1 parcel containing 21 residential units at 412 Evergreen Avenue in Bushwick. The deal closed on October 9, 2020 and was recorded on October 26, 2020.
The property contains a total of 25,268 square feet of built space.
The average loan per unit is $411,190.
The DOB issued a new construction (NB) initial temporary certificate of occupancy for the building with 21 residential units on May 21, 2019.
Over the past five years, there have been 3 NYC Department of Buildings permit applications filed for this parcel valued at more than $20,000. There was one renovation/alteration project (A2) applied for with a total estimated value of $100,000.There has been one new building permit application totaling 19,171 square feet. Those plans include a total of 21 residential units. There has been one demolition project filed for the parcels over the past five years.
